How Dicef CV 250mg/125mg Tablet works:

Each Dicef CV 250mg/125mg tablet unites Cefuroxime, an antibiotic, with Clavulanic Acid, a beta-lactamase inhibitor. Cefuroxime combats bacterial growth by disrupting their protective shell, crucial for their survival. Clavulanic Acid counteracts bacterial enzymes that would otherwise neutralize Cefuroxime, thus broadening Cefuroxime's effectiveness and overcoming bacterial resistance.

FAQs on Dicef CV 250mg/125mg Tablet

Dicef CV 250mg/125mg tablets treat only bacterial infections; they are ineffective against viral infections like colds and the flu.
Patients allergic to any component of Dicef CV 250mg/125mg Tablets should not use this medication. Always disclose your medical history to your doctor before starting treatment to minimize potential side effects.
Diarrhea is a possible side effect of Dicef CV 250mg/125mg Tablets, as antibiotics can disrupt the beneficial bacteria in your gut. Stay hydrated by drinking plenty of fluids if diarrhea occurs. Persistent diarrhea warrants a doctor's consultation. Always consult your doctor before taking any other medication.
Continue taking your Dicef CV 250mg/125mg Tablet as prescribed, completing the entire course even if you feel better. Full recovery requires finishing the medication, as symptoms can improve before the infection is fully eradicated.
